Given the graph we are asked to find the cost of one ticket. This can be seen below.
Explanation
From the graph, we can see that at the point when zero tickets had been sold, the students had raised 100 dollars. After one ticket was sold, the money increased to 125 dollars. Then after 2 tickets, it further increased by 25 dollars to 150 and so on so forth.
Therefore, we can say that the cost of one ticket is:
Answer: 25 dollars
